Discover how a creative mindset can help you live up to your potential, remove fear, and embrace innovation Norm Laviolette has honed his talents through performing and presenting to thousands of people over the years. His unique comedy-inspired corporate training programs have been wildly successful, helping organizations such as Intel, Google, Twitter, and Nokia enhance their corporate cultures, strengthen teamwork and leadership, and instill powerful communication skills. His innovative blend of improvisation techniques and effective team-building methods has inspired and motivated people around the world. The Art of Making Sh!t Up: Using the Principles of Improv to Become an Unstoppable Powerhouse shares the lessons Norm has learned from his personal experiences founding and growing several multimillion-dollar companies. This engaging, lively, and sometimes irreverent book enables anyone to discover, develop, and employ their creative mindset. Unforgettable chapters—with titles such as Ushers, Vomit, and Why People Clean Bathrooms, The Fear of Looking Stupid, Patiently Impatient, and People Don't think About You as Much As You Think They Do—take readers on a humorous, yet meaningful, journey to creative freedom, personal growth, and professional success. The Art of Making Sh!t Up enables readers to: Remove the fear of failure and ignite the creative mindset within you Learn to listen to yourself and recognize when and how to trust your instincts Embrace and celebrate the ideas of others to create an inclusive and diverse culture Listen to other people and the surrounding environment to spark great ideas Communicate simply, clearly, and leave a meaningful, memorable, and positive impression on all those around you The Art of Making Sh!t Up will help develop and use new skill sets to be more productive, more accepting, and more "all in" to create a stronger teammate and team. As Norm says, "Since we are already bull-shitting our way through a good majority of our lives, we might as well embrace that fact and learn to use it for good instead of ill."
